    Old Hall Farm is a home that’s bound to stir the heart - an individual detached residence full of charm and character, set within a generous and idyllic plot in the much-loved hamlet of Cow Hill.

    While the property would now benefit from a programme of modernisation, it offers the incoming buyer an exciting opportunity to tailor and enhance the space over time, preserving its character while adding their own personal touch.

    The accommodation begins with a welcoming entrance porch, opening through a solid internal door into a hallway rich with period detail, including built-in storage, a graceful staircase to the first floor, and double doors leading into a lovely dual-aspect living room with open fire. The breakfast kitchen features a range of fitted units, a Sandyford AGA with two-ring hot plate and oven, a Belfast sink with mixer tap set into wooden worktops, space for a tall fridge freezer, and a door through to the rear porch.

    Upstairs, a central landing leads to three bedrooms, an airing cupboard, and a well-proportioned 3pc family bathroom.

    The setting is as appealing as the house itself. A pebbled driveway leads to a gated hardstanding area with a range of outbuildings, including three stables, a tack room, two car ports, an outdoor store, and WC. The formal gardens are attractively laid to lawn, framed by mature trees, hedging, and well-stocked borders. Beyond lies an adjoining field, gently sloping and extending the total plot to just under 1.5 acres.
